Visiting an Inmate: What You Need to Know
Visiting a loved one in jail can be an important way to offer support, but it requires proper preparation. Each facility has its own visitation schedule and rules, so it is important to check the details before planning your visit.
Most jails require visitors to bring valid identification and follow a specific dress code. Arriving early and being prepared can help ensure a smooth experience. Failing to follow the rules may result in denied entry, so it is always best to review the guidelines in advance.
For those who cannot visit in person, many facilities offer alternatives such as video calls or phone communication. These options make it easier to stay connected, even from a distance. However, it is important to remember that most communications are monitored for security reasons.
Posting Bail and Providing Support
When someone is arrested, one of the first questions people ask is how to secure their release. Bail allows an inmate to leave jail temporarily while waiting for court proceedings. The amount is determined by the court and depends on various factors.
There are different ways to pay bail. Some people pay the full amount directly, while others choose to work with bail bond agents who charge a fee for their services. Understanding these options can help you make the best decision for your situation.
